Guymon was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their fourth straight loss. They fell just short of the Cimarron Bluejays by a score of 2-1. The Tigers were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Bluejays apparently hadn't forgotten their defeat the last time these teams played back in September of 2023.
Guymon started the match hot and won the first set, but they struggled down the stretch and lost the last two.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-27, 25-18, 25-19.
Among those leading the charge was Kynlee Frink, who had 17 digs. She is on a roll when it comes to digs, as she's now had ten or more in the last four games she's played dating back to last season.
Guymon's loss dropped their record down to 8-7. As for Cimarron, the win (which was their eighth in a row) raised their record to 9-2.
Guymon will face off against Claremore at 9:00 a.m. on Friday. As for Cimarron, they did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next game, a 2-0 victory vs. Ulysses on the 24th.
